Breakfast at hotel. Coach drive to Glendalough, Co Wicklow, known as the Garden of Ireland - approx 1 hr drive from Dublin. St. Kevin founded this early Christian monastic site in the 6th century. Set in a glaciated valley with two lakes, the monastic remains include a superb round tower, stone churches and decorated crosses. St Kevin is thought to have come from the more fertile lands of County Kildare and like many other men of sanctity in early times, desired solitude for his life of prayer and contemplation. He therefore withdrew into the thinly peopled mountains and set up his hermitage at Glendalough. Shopping and relaxation in for the remainder of the day. Dinner is independent this evening.

From Dublin travel through the midlands of the country to Clonmacnoise. known as one of the most famous monuments, you will see this 6th century monastic settlement founded by St. Ciaran which contains the remains of nine Churches and a Round Tower dating from the 10th to the 16th century. The monastic settlement has seen many violent and destructive periods in its history and was destroyed by fire at least 13 times. It was attacked approximately 40 times from the 8th - 12th. Century, 8 times by the Vikings; 6 times by the Anglo Normans and 26 times by the Irish. Each time of attack it was rebuilt by the Monks who resided there and today it is one of Ireland’s most famous visitor centres. Arrive to Galway City and check into hotel. Dinner independent. Breakfast at hotel. Today explore the ‘Ring of Kerry’, 170 km of some of Ireland's most spectacular scenery. The Ring of Kerry offers magnificent panoramas of the Atlantic Ocean and the rugged coastline of south-west Ireland contrasting with the rich and varied vegetation nurtured by the Gulf Stream. Kilkenny Castle overlooks the River Nore and dominates the 'High Town' of Kilkenny City. Over the eight centuries of its existence, many additions and alterations have been made to the fabric of the building, making Kilkenny Castle today a complex structure of various architectural styles.
